55 degrees Fahrenheit is approximately 12.8 degrees Celsius. To convert Fahrenheit to Celsius, subtract 32 from the Fahrenheit temperature and then multiply by 5/9.
Using cold water below 55 degrees Fahrenheit can slow down the effectiveness of the chlorine sanitizer solution. It may result in chlorine not dissolving properly or taking longer to disinfect surfaces. The ideal temperature for chlorine sanitizer solutions is between 75-120 degrees Fahrenheit for efficient sanitization.
The fusion temperature of impression compound is typically around 55-60 degrees Celsius (131-140 degrees Fahrenheit). It is important to heat the compound to this temperature to soften it for manipulation and molding in dental impressions.
